Zuersteinmal Hallo - mein erster Post
Ich möchte:
1. Programm starten
2. einen (Default-)Button Klick simulieren
3. warten, bis das Programm idlet
4. eine aufploppende MsgBox (Infobox, nur OK-Button) beenden
5. Programm beenden
1 krieg ich hin. Für 2 nutze ich PostMegssage mit vk_return. bei 3 versuch ich es mit "WaitForInputIdl".
Und 5 würde ich wieder mit Postmessage (tab und dann return) regeln.
Doch richtig, nur würde ... denn 4 bereitet mir arge Probleme.
Ich krieg es auf biegen und brechen nicht hin, das
handle dieses buttons der Infobox zu bekommen

Ich kriege das
Handle der Infobox einfach nicht heraus. Gebe ich dessen
Handle an, krieg ich mit FindWindowEx wunderbar das
handle des Buttons und kann ihn auch betätigen. Doch irgendwie scheint die Klasse der Box ('#32770') ein Problem dar zu stellen.
Code:
wnd := FindWindowEx(wnd,0,'#32770','fat
GUI');
Damit hab ich es versucht - jedoch ohne Erfolg.
Code:
wnd := FindWindowEx(
handle,0,'Button','OK');
Wenn ich das entsprechende
Handle der Box direkt angebe, findet er mit dieser Zeile den Button.
Wäre über Hilfe dankbar
Gruß
Malte